Tech specs
Platform
Windows phone 8.1
Processor
Qualcomm Snapdragon 801, Quad-core, 2.3GHz
Memory1
32GB, 2GB DDR3, Micro SD support (up to 128GB)
Networks
LTE3: 700/AWS/1800/2600MHz; GSM/GPRS/EDGE: 850/900/1800/1900 MHz; WCDMA: 850/900/1900/2100 MHz; CDMA: 800/1900 MHz (BC0/BC1)
Display
5-inch, Full HD 1080p, 440ppi, Super LCD3 with Corning Gorilla Glass 3
Battery2
2600 mAh, embedded Li-Polymer
Main camera
5 MP, 88-degree wide angle lens, Duo camera with UltraPixel, BSI sensor, Pixel size 2.0 µm,Sensor size 1/3‘, f/2.0 aperture, 28mm lens, 2 x LED dual flash, HTC ImageChip 2, HDR capture
Video camera
1080 pixels, Full HD
Audio
HTC BoomSound, with max volume of 95 decibels
Dimensions
5.76 x 2.77 x 0.36 inches (LxWxH)
Weight
5.64 ounces
